Navigating the intricate of ad network pricing structures can be a daunting task for advertisers. However, by grasping the fundamental concepts, you can efficiently allocate your advertising budget and maximize your return on ad spend.

Ad networks typically employ various pricing models, such as impression-based pricing, cost per view, and performance-based. Each model deviates in terms of how advertisers are invoiced.

For instance, CPC pricing focuses around paying a here fee for every tap on your advertisement. On the other hand, CPM pricing bills advertisers based on the number of views their ads generate.

Understanding these different pricing structures is crucial for developing a profitable advertising plan.

By carefully analyzing your marketing objectives and deciphering the nuances of each pricing model, you can make informed decisions that align with your budget and boost your advertising ROI.
